> In future I think there should just be one plugin, say VCdiff for all 
> common version control systems. The behaviour should be very similar, 
> just with different command names, which could be stored in an array. 
> Then the user just sets an option for the VC they want (or perhaps it 
> could even be autodetected by looking for CVS/.svn/.hg/... 
> subdirectories).

I like this idea very much. But I'd like to suggest to call it geanyVC
and set up to goal for some 1.0 to support nearly complete
functionality of the most popular version control systems svn, git
and cvs. That includes add, revert, diff, commit, checkout... I know,
it's a lot to do, but with a little help and time it should be
possible ;). Maybe we could set up a new project at sf.net, so
development of Geany will not be disturbed. What do you think about it?
